Title

RELATIONSHIP BETWEEN THE BREAST CANCER HISTORY AND PROSTATE CANCER IN RELATIVES WITH PROSTATE CANCER

Pages

  7-11

Abstract

 BACKGROUND AND OBJECTIVE: The FAMILY history of breast and prostatism cancer is a risk factor for PROSTATE CANCER. Considering the common pathogens for prostate and BREAST CANCERs, the aim of this study was to determine the RELATIONSHIP between the patient's PROSTATE CANCER and their first and SECOND-CLASS RELATIVES with the history of BREAST CANCER.METHODS: This case-control study was conducted on 300 patients who underwent biopsy in Shahid Beheshti hospital due to prostate enlargement. Patients were divided into two groups based on biopsy: a) PROSTATE CANCER in case group and benign prostate enlargement in control group. Additional information of the first and SECOND-CLASS RELATIVES of patients was collected in the checklist and evaluated. The patients (150 control, 150 experimental) were selected using simple sampling method. The experimental and control groups who underwent biopsy suffered from PROSTATE CANCER and benign prostate enlargement, respectively.FINDINGS: The mean age of patients was 72.17 ± 9.788 and 70.01 ± 9.921 in case and control group, respectively. The frequency of BREAST CANCER in the FAMILY of patients with PROSTATE CANCER and healthy persons was 16 (59.3%) and 11 (40.3%), respectively. Moreover, the frequency of BREAST CANCER was greater in first than SECOND-CLASS RELATIVES in both groups, while this difference was not statistically significant. In both groups, the history of BREAST CANCER was higher in patients older than 40 years.CONCLUSION: The results of the study indicated that the frequency of PROSTATE CANCER is probably higher if the first and SECOND-CLASS RELATIVES affect with PROSTATE CANCER than BREAST CANCER.
